Development of a Student Social Anxiety Model Based on Uncompromising Perfectionism and Experiential Avoidance with a Mediating Role of Difficulty in Emotion Regulation
The current research was conducted to formulate students' social anxiety models based on uncompromising perfectionism, experiential avoidance, and the mediating role of difficulty in emotion regulation. The method of descriptive-correlational research was structural equation modeling. The stati...
